When you're preparing Italian meals, make sure you have the right temperature so your foods are prepared correctly. Use this handy chart for converting cooking temperatures to Fahrenheit and/or Celsius.

Fahrenheit Celsius
250° 120°
275° 135°
300° 150°
325° 160°
350° 175°
375° 190°
400° 205°
425° 220°
450° 230°
475° 245°
500° 260°

If you run into a problem with measurements while preparing your favorite Italian dish, use this quick guide to find the metric equivalents for common cooking amounts:

This Measurement . . . . . . Equals This Measurement
1 tablespoon 15 milliliters
1 cup 250 milliliters
1 quart 1 liter
1 ounce 28 grams
1 pound 454 grams
